Is Vitex shortening my cycles already???

I started taking Vitex on the first day of this cycle. A few days after my period ended I started having lots of watery and ewcm, which is really early for me. My cycles have been irregular and ovulation usually doesn't come around CD 20 so for me to have lots of fertile cm on CD 10 is different but good, I just thought it took a while for it to work based on what others have said!

My understanding is that it takes a few months for vitex to have an effect. Vitex is regulating irregular cycles and also lengthens the luteal phase. Best wishes.
